These guys were busy bees the whole entire time. We split up into several different teams. On Wednesday there were three teams: two went out to help elderly with their yards/roofs while Elisabeth and I stayed behind with Charlotte Lofton (from Magnolia Baptist Church) to clean up the facilities and sort out all of our goodies to give out. The church was used for those evacuating during the hurricane. The whole church was upside down. It took literally ALL day to get the facilities in shape for the team to stay there safely! Great job!!

 

On Thursday, we split up into teams again with half working on debri and tree removal and the other half taking food, toiletries, and other basic survival necessities out to the people in Laurel and the surrounding area. We passed out over 100 boxes of groceries and other necessities and over 150 cases of water. Over 50 others came by the church to pick up boxes of groceries and clothes. We were able to feed many of them the first warm meal that they had eaten since the hurricane. Such an incredible blessing! It was AMAZING!

 

On Friday, we split up into 4 teams to focus on helping with debri and tree removal and securing roofs for those in need. We also took out all of the remaining cases of water and boxes of groceries, toiletries, and extras.
